The Sales and Leadership Development Program (SLDP) is a 2 year program for recent graduates with a degree in Industrial Distribution or Supply Chain and provides a path to management or sales with the opportunity to learn and grow into the role. Starting with insides sales, you will be responsible for greeting customers and taking orders of HVAC products and supplies, assisting customers with warranty returns and credits, as well as handling customer inquiries regarding products and/or services. You should provide friendly and efficient service to ensure maximum customer satisfaction. The SLDP Employee should make sure the customer receives the correct products in the correct quantity at the correct time so they can keep members of our community comfortable in their homes and workplaces.
Sales & Leadership Duties Include:
- Learn (through classroom, presentations, showing, and hands-on activities) the duties and responsibilities of receiving, picking, insides sales, outside sales, and counter sales; and be able to perform those duties.
- Learn in an accelerated timeline by shadowing/participating in each essential job function, such as: receiving, picking, delivery driving, counter sales, inside sales.
- Enroll and actively progress in the HARDI Inside Sales Certification Program.
Typical duties for Inside Sales include but are not limited to:
- Prepare quote orders for customers
- Prepare invoice orders taken via telephone, fax, or over the counter
- Process sales by credit card, cash, or checks and verifying customers are authorized company personnel
- Issue credits for items returned according to company policy
- Assist warehouse personnel in pulling and preparing sold products using automated machinery for assistance
- Assist, troubleshoot and/or research customers inquiries regarding products and/or services
- Perform cycle counting and/or daily deposits according to branch schedule
- Maintain general appearance of branch showroom, warehouse and grounds
- Ensure that each customer leaves the store satisfied
